Patents Represented by Attorney Novak Druce & Quigg, LLP
-
Patent number: 8347316Abstract: A system and method provide for synchronous operation of linked command objects in a general purpose software application. The software application provides a user with a variety of operations that manipulate available data objects. The software application manages the data objects in a number of contexts. Each context manages the existence and execution of a number of command objects. Each command object operates on one or more data objects in its context. To support synchronous operations that affect the state of data objects in more than one context, command objects are linked to each other. When one command object is executed, the context of the command object identifies a command object linked to the executed command object and initiates the execution of the linked command object via the context that manages that command object. This synchronization allows for synchronous undo and redone operations. The delete states of the command objects are also synchronized.Type: GrantFiled: March 29, 2010Date of Patent: January 1, 2013Assignee: Apple Inc.Inventors: Gregory S. Friedman, Thomas W. Becker
-
Patent number: 8346072Abstract: Methods and devices for implementing a camera restriction on a wireless handheld communication device. As more handheld devices incorporate camera functionalities, organizations and individuals with privacy concerns are more vulnerable to unauthorized disclosure. The camera restriction prevents a user from taking a picture of a subject if the device has not been steadily focused on the subject in question for a predetermined period of time. In short, this process extends the normal camera-taking procedure and thus requires the camera user to take pictures in a conspicuous manner—the rationale being that a camera user would be less likely to take unauthorized pictures if such actions could be easily recognized. The camera restriction can be communicated to the device via a wireless communication network. Additionally, the restrictions and boundaries can be communicated to the device as part of an IT security policy.Type: GrantFiled: July 26, 2012Date of Patent: January 1, 2013Assignee: Research In Motion LimitedInventor: Archer Chi Kwong Wun
-
Patent number: 8346799Abstract: A search facility may optimize search result ranking by applying inverted decay transformations to history-dependent ranking components. Ranking scores for content in a content collection may be based on a set of ranking components including history-dependent ranking components. History-dependent ranking components may be based on historical behavioral data such as historical searches, actions taken with respect to content such as viewing content and content-related purchases. Content recently added to the content collection may be disadvantaged relative to content with an established history. Inverted decay transformations may correspond to simulations of additional historical behavioral data.Type: GrantFiled: April 23, 2010Date of Patent: January 1, 2013Assignee: A9.com, Inc.Inventors: François Huet, Anil A. Sewani, Daniel E. Rose
-
Patent number: 8346901Abstract: Methods and arrangements for selecting a content source from a plurality of potential content sources based on program information are described. A network resource maintains a mapping between itself and a static URL to be accessed by an application when updating content used in the application. The network resource can receive, over an electronic network, a configuration request providing the static URL and program information that at least identifies the application and version of the application. Based on the received information that is specific to the identified application version and from which content specific for that application version can be obtained, the network resource determines a second URL and provides the second URL to the application in response to the request.Type: GrantFiled: January 26, 2009Date of Patent: January 1, 2013Assignee: Apple Inc.Inventor: Tony F. Kinnis
-
Patent number: 8347302Abstract: Technology is provided to manage requests for physical resources in computing systems using system-aware scheduling techniques. Transactions having two or more dependent requests for a physical resource are identified by the computing system. Information identifying the requests as part of a dependent transaction is passed with the requests for the physical resource. In at least one mode of operation, a scheduler corresponding to the physical resource allocates submission of the requests to the physical resource using the dependent transaction information.Type: GrantFiled: October 9, 2008Date of Patent: January 1, 2013Assignee: Amazon Technologies, Inc.Inventors: Pradeep Vincent, Swaminathan Sivasubramanian
-
Patent number: 8343226Abstract: A humeral prosthesis, for the articulation of a humerus in a scapula of a shoulder having a glenoid cavity, includes an articulation device able to be associated both with an articulation element mounted on the glenoid cavity, and also at the top of said humerus by an attachment element. The articulation device comprises a first element able to articulate with the articulation element and a second element associated with the attachment element, the first element and the second element being pivoted to each other around a pivoting axis to allow a free relative rotation thereof around the pivoting axis.Type: GrantFiled: July 2, 2008Date of Patent: January 1, 2013Assignee: LIMA-LTO SpAInventors: Livio Nogarin, Roberto Rotini, Paolo Dalla Pria
-
Patent number: 8341146Abstract: A method for displaying a search history for a user is shown. The method includes generating a search history for a user including one or more listings of search results, displaying a first search result listing on a web page, and displaying at least a second search result listing on the web page, the second search result listing having a relationship to the first search result listing within the search history.Type: GrantFiled: April 18, 2011Date of Patent: December 25, 2012Assignee: A9.com, Inc.Inventors: Colin D. Bleckner, Colin M. Saunders
-
Patent number: 8339990Abstract: A system and method uses a communication request and/or historical data collected by one or more devices to identify whether to fulfill the request using ad hoc networking or access points. If an access point is determined to be used, the system and method attempts to identify those access points that can best fulfill the request and then attempts to use such access points to fulfill the request.Type: GrantFiled: September 21, 2007Date of Patent: December 25, 2012Assignee: Dash Navigation, Inc.Inventor: Assimakis Tzamaloukas
-
Patent number: 8340898Abstract: A system and method splices into, or replaces routes identified based on road geometry with routes taken by the same user or other users to create alternate routes that may be selected by a user to display, for example, on a map or for which driving directions can be displayed. Communication of routes traveled by different devices may be received from a server or from another device. A naming convention for road segments and ordered paths of road segments is described.Type: GrantFiled: September 21, 2010Date of Patent: December 25, 2012Assignee: Dash Navigation, Inc.Inventors: Robert Eldredge Currie, Assimakis Tzamaloukas
-
Patent number: 8340735Abstract: A circuit board in a mobile electronic device has a microphone and related amplifier and signal conditioning circuitry mounted thereon. A radio frequency (RF) shield surrounds and isolates the microphone from electromagnetic interference (EMI). The RF shield together with the circuit board forms an acoustic chamber surrounding the microphone. A hole in the RF shield permits acoustic energy to enter the acoustic chamber and reach the microphone.Type: GrantFiled: August 6, 2010Date of Patent: December 25, 2012Assignee: Research In Motion LimitedInventor: Wolfgang Edeler
-
Patent number: 8340840Abstract: A method and device for reducing on an aircraft lateral effects of a turbulence. The device (1) includes means (2, 3, 5, 7, A1, A2) for calculating and applying a roll control command and a yaw control command enabling the side effects generated by a turbulence event to be attenuated on the aircraft.Type: GrantFiled: July 30, 2010Date of Patent: December 25, 2012Assignee: Airbus Operations (SAS)Inventor: Stéphane Puig
-
Patent number: 8339385Abstract: A self calibrating imaging display system and machine-readable storage for such systems are provided, which perform various steps. The steps include forwarding a display test pattern, where the display test pattern including a measurement field comprising approximately 10% of a total number of pixels displayed by a screen and where the measurement field can be placed at different regions of the screen. The steps also include causing the measurement field to be stepped through a sequence of values. The steps further include receiving luminance and color values from photosensors to detect distinct luminance and color levels at the different regions of the screen. The steps also include determining luminance and color correction factors by comparing the detected luminance and color values to reference luminance and color data. The steps additionally include applying the determined luminance and color correction factors to the different regions of the screen.Type: GrantFiled: January 5, 2009Date of Patent: December 25, 2012Assignee: International Business Machines CorporationInventors: Sussan S. Coley, Victor S. Moore, Robert M. Szabo
-
Patent number: 8341143Abstract: Methods and apparatus for rendering search results are described. In one aspect of the invention, a search request is received from a computerized client. A search is performed based on the search request in at least two different categories of information to obtain search results in the searched categories. Selected search results are returned to the client to facilitate rendering the search results at the client. Search results from different search categories are returned in a manner configured to be presented in different panes of a graphical user interface rendered on the client. In another aspect, what searches to perform can be determined based at least in part upon search results display settings associated with the client, such that searches are performed only in categories of information that are associated with a pane that is in an open state on the client.Type: GrantFiled: September 2, 2004Date of Patent: December 25, 2012Assignee: A9.com, Inc.Inventors: Jason Karls, Ruben E. Ortega, Udi Manber
-
Patent number: 8340225Abstract: An IQ-imbalance of a complex receiver can be corrected by compensating the in-phase signal component and the quadrature-phase signal component produced by the complex receiver for an IQ-imbalance estimated by analyzing the in-phase signal component and the quadrature-phase signal component. A carrier signal can be received at the complex receiver. An in-phase signal component and a quadrature-phase signal component can be generated from the carrier signal. The generated in-phase signal component and the generated quadrature-phase signal component can be analyzed to estimate an IQ-imbalance. Based on the estimated IQ-imbalance, the in-phase signal component and quadrature-phase signal component can be compensated to correct the IQ-imbalance.Type: GrantFiled: October 16, 2009Date of Patent: December 25, 2012Assignee: SiTune CorporationInventors: Mahdi Khoshgard, Vahid Toosi, Marzieh Veyseh
-
Patent number: 8336747Abstract: A bicycle rack includes at least one arm and a cradle installed on the arm for receiving a bicycle thereon. The cradle has a body including a through-hole extending through the longitudinal length of the body. The through-hole is sized to be received by the arm of a bicycle rack. A saddle extending along a length of the longitudinal body is positioned above the through-hole and has a top surface for receiving a tube of a bicycle. The saddle is oriented cross-ways to the longitudinal axis of the through-hole. The top surface of the saddle can increase in dimension on one side of a vertical axis of the through-hole and decreases in dimension on the other side of the vertical axis as the saddle extends toward each end of the longitudinal body. A latch is positioned on opposite sides of the vertical axis at either end of the saddle.Type: GrantFiled: February 15, 2011Date of Patent: December 25, 2012Assignee: Thule Sweden ABInventors: Kevin Bogoslofski, John R. Laverack
-
Patent number: 8340151Abstract: A system and method for addition of broad-area semiconductor laser diode arrays are described. The system can include an array of laser diodes, a V-shaped external cavity, and grating systems to provide feedback for phase-locking of the laser diode array. A V-shaped mirror used to couple the laser diode emissions along two optical paths can be a V-shaped prism mirror, a V-shaped stepped mirror or include multiple V-shaped micro-mirrors. The V-shaped external cavity can be a ring cavity. The system can include an external injection laser to further improve coherence and phase-locking.Type: GrantFiled: December 13, 2010Date of Patent: December 25, 2012Assignee: UT-Battelle, LLCInventors: Bo Liu, Yun Liu, Yehuda Y. Braiman
-
Patent number: 8339472Abstract: An apparatus and method for capturing an image on a mobile device having a flash comprising a red light source and a white light source is presented herein. A detection of a color spectrum of ambient light is made using image data sensed by an image sensor. Additionally, a determination of an intensity of red light when combined with an associated intensity of white light results in a color spectrum that substantially matches the color spectrum of the ambient light. The flash emits white light from the white light source of the flash and red light from the red light source of the flash. An image from a camera module is recorded during the emission of the white and red light.Type: GrantFiled: May 28, 2010Date of Patent: December 25, 2012Assignee: Research In Motion LimitedInventors: Yochanan Cliel Manoach Gilbert-Schachter, Marc Drader
-
Patent number: 8335790Abstract: The invention relates to a device (1) for transmitting to a user system (3) geographical data that is stored, using a unit-surface sorting, in the database (4) of a provider system (2).Type: GrantFiled: August 4, 2008Date of Patent: December 18, 2012Assignee: Airbus Operations (SAS)Inventors: Thomas Sauvalle, Eric Peyrucain, André Bourdais
-
Patent number: 8334705Abstract: An integrated circuit comprises logic circuitry driven by a clock and reference circuitry. In operation, logic elements of the reference circuitry are synchronized to the clock. In operation, a first sensing circuit outputs a voltage VC proportional to an instantaneous current consumption IC of the logic circuitry, and a second sensing circuit outputs a voltage VR proportional to an instantaneous fluctuating current consumption IR of the reference circuitry. In operation, differential circuitry outputs a voltage difference ?VR?VC between a scaled-up version ?VR of the voltage VR and the voltage VC, the scaled-up version scaled to approximately the scale of the voltage VC. In operation, a square root circuit receives the voltage difference as input and outputs a square root of the voltage difference. A current source is controllable by the output of the square root circuit to generate current through a dissipative load.Type: GrantFiled: October 27, 2011Date of Patent: December 18, 2012Assignee: Certicom Corp.Inventors: Kiran Kumar Gunnam, Jay Scott Fuller
-
Patent number: 8335719Abstract: A method and system for generating advertisement sets for keywords automatically extracted from data feeds is provided. An advertisement system receives various data feeds. The advertisement system may on a periodic or an ad hoc basis request a feed server to provide the latest feed having feed items. Each feed item may include a title, a description, and a link to an associated web site. To generate an advertisement set, which includes an advertisement, a keyword, and a link to a landing page, the advertisement system extracts a keyword from a feed item, identifies a category for advertising using the extracted keyword, generates an advertisement (or “creative”) for advertising that category, and generates a landing page link associated with the category. The advertisement system then submits the advertisement set to an advertisement placement service for placement along with content that is somehow related to the keyword.Type: GrantFiled: June 26, 2007Date of Patent: December 18, 2012Assignee: Amazon Technologies, Inc.Inventors: Waseem S. Quraishi, Joel Andrew Shapiro